Ignition Lock Cly. Locked!

1979 RX-7 and the ignition key wont turn past unlocking the steering wheel. Once I remove the assembly can I easily remove the lock cylinder to remove the bent or binding tumbler rather than replacing the whole assembly? I work at a Mazda dealership and my lead tech said take the assembly to a locksmith to repair rather than replace it. My service manuals say nothing about removal of the lock cyl. from the locking collar. Anybody out there done this repair before? Just trying to repair this myself and save some time and money.

is the steering locked as well? if it is, put the key in and hit the steering wheel in an upward motion, turning it to the right with your left hand, and turn the key with your right hand. that should unlock it. it's happened to me a ton of times.
